java - JAVA StringJoiner 是线程安全的吗?

标签 java

谁能告诉我 StringJoiner 是否是线程安全的?

我知道 StringBuilderStringBuffer 之间的区别,但找不到有关 StringJoiner 的信息。

最佳答案

不同于StringBuffer同步的方法(如 append() ), StringJoiner 的方法(如 add())不是同步。因此它不是 thread-safe .

源代码来自 OpenJDK :

关于java - JAVA StringJoiner 是线程安全的吗?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/52269106/

相关文章:

java - Play中的Hot redeploy和Spring Boot中的自动重启的区别

java - 什么是IndexOutOfBoundsException?我该如何解决?

java显示方法

java字符串日期转换

java - 无法附加到 java 中的文本文件。可以创建 .txt 文件并添加数据,但会被覆盖

java - 如何以编程方式启用 UDP/IP 广播?

java - 扩展不同基类的类包装器

java - 处理包含数学操作数的 Java 字符串

java - 如何在 GTalk、Skype 等 IM 应用中管理在线用户

java - 从命令行运行基于 JasperReports 的应用程序时出现 NoClassDefFoundError